The U.S. Dollar spiked during the stock market's meltdown in March. But now that financial markets are calming down and stocks are rallying, the U.S. Dollar has fallen to a 2 month low.

When the USD Index spiked more than 5% above its 50 dma and then fell to a 2 month low, the USD's returns over the next few weeks and months were mixed. Sometimes the USD continued to fall further in the short term, and sometimes the USD reversed and rallied. But over the next year, many of these historical cases saw the USD drop since they occurred near the top of a major USD rally.
